The global blockchain in fintech market reached USD 1.5 BN in 2022 and is poised to grow to USD 50.7 BN by 2032, with 47.90% CAGR during the review period (2023-2032). The market dynamics of blockchain within the fintech sector have witnessed a profound transformation in recent years, revolutionizing the traditional financial landscape. Blockchain, the decentralized and distributed ledger technology, has emerged as a disruptive force, bringing transparency, security, and efficiency to financial transactions. Banks and other financial entities are leveraging blockchain to streamline operations, curtail costs, and enhance security. This adoption has created a ripple effect, influencing the overall market structure and dynamics. One fundamental shift in the market dynamics is the emphasis on decentralized finance (DeFi).
Blockchain facilitates the creation of decentralized financial systems that operate without traditional intermediaries. This has opened up new avenues for individuals around the world, enabling them to access banking services without the need for a traditional bank account. The rise of decentralized applications (DApps) on blockchain platforms has further fueled the growth of DeFi, providing users with various financial services, including lending, borrowing, and trading, in a trustless and permissionless environment. Interoperability is another key driver shaping the market dynamics of blockchain in fintech. As the fintech landscape becomes increasingly diverse, there is a growing need for different blockchain networks to communicate and interact seamlessly. Interoperability solutions enable the transfer of assets and data across disparate blockchain platforms, fostering collaboration and connectivity. This interoperability is crucial for the evolution of a global financial infrastructure built on blockchain, where various systems can work together cohesively to deliver more robust and versatile financial services.
Security remains a paramount concern in the fintech sector, and blockchain's inherent features contribute significantly to addressing this challenge. The immutability of blockchain records and the cryptographic techniques used in its implementation ensure a high level of security for financial transactions. Market dynamics are, therefore, witnessing a shift towards blockchain solutions as financial institutions prioritize the safeguarding of sensitive data and the prevention of fraudulent activities. The trustless nature of blockchain transactions, where parties can engage without requiring a central authority, adds an extra layer of security to the entire fintech ecosystem. The emergence of central bank digital currencies (CBDCs) is also playing a pivotal role in shaping the market dynamics of blockchain in fintech.
Governments and central banks worldwide are exploring the use of blockchain technology to create their own digital currencies. CBDCs offer a digitized form of traditional fiat currency, providing a secure and efficient medium of exchange. This development not only represents a convergence of traditional finance and blockchain but also signifies a transformative shift in the way governments approach monetary policy and financial transactions.
